X-Git-Url: https://git.street.me.uk/andy/viking.git/blobdiff_plain/ddc47a46f3a6b10f73c527d63beeaa0b18db980f..8cd10bb4dc58e659a2f1527c4eb5927320540898:/src/viktrack.h diff --git a/src/viktrack.h b/src/viktrack.h index 0244ae23..b74cea52 100644 --- a/src/viktrack.h +++ b/src/viktrack.h @@ -22,6 +22,11 @@ #ifndef _VIKING_TRACK_H #define _VIKING_TRACK_H +#include +#include + +#include "vikcoord.h" + /* todo important: put these in their own header file, maybe.probably also rename */ #define VIK_TRACK(x) ((VikTrack *)(x)) @@ -69,7 +74,7 @@ gdouble vik_track_get_average_speed(const VikTrack *tr); void vik_track_convert ( VikTrack *tr, VikCoordMode dest_mode ); gdouble *vik_track_make_elevation_map ( const VikTrack *tr, guint16 num_chunks ); void vik_track_get_total_elevation_gain(const VikTrack *tr, gdouble *up, gdouble *down); -VikCoord *vik_track_get_closest_tp_by_percentage_dist ( VikTrack *tr, gdouble reldist ); +VikTrackpoint *vik_track_get_closest_tp_by_percentage_dist ( VikTrack *tr, gdouble reldist ); gdouble *vik_track_make_speed_map ( const VikTrack *tr, guint16 num_chunks ); gboolean vik_track_get_minmax_alt ( const VikTrack *tr, gdouble *min_alt, gdouble *max_alt ); void vik_track_marshall ( VikTrack *tr, guint8 **data, guint *len);